Png to bitmap font The window… Feb 8, 2018 · \$\begingroup\$ I have found the open source tool mpskit which is capable of decoding . The first time you enable the plugin, a new setting is added to your project settings. Note: the grid should be consistent-sized, as if you were drawing a tileset. Oct 27, 2018 · I created a bitmap font, basically a 256x256 png image where each character occupies 8x8 tile. Jan 13, 2025 · I’m working on a low-resolution Unity project (480x270) and want to use a bitmap font (PNG sprite sheet) for pixel-perfect text. ttf file in Unity with same depth and color. Vector fonts don't do discrete sizes (especially small) very well. ttf file I found two pretty straight forward ways which both involve the open-source program fontforge (Link to their website): GUI Way (Suitable for extracting a handful of characters): Open the . PNG supports three main types of raster images: grayscale image, a color indexed image and the color image. Convert the PNG and FNT to C++ Structures. I have to implement these fonts into Unity Engine, but the problem is that Unity likes to work with vector fonts and doesn't have the best support for bitmap fonts. Font To Bitmap Converter. These adjustments will impact the texture file generated during the export process. Fortunately these types of bitmap fonts are pretty standard. Adding bitmap-font texture to your project. Start using jimp in your project by running `npm i jimp`. ttf", point_size) for char in string. com I present…Glyphite! A beautiful, fast, and affordable Bitmap font builder. ttf file in fontforge click on the character you want to export. /' fileName: string: The file name of the . Jun 25, 2023 · CP only supports bitmap fonts, so you’ll need a font converted to BDF (ascii) or PCF (binary) format. png. fnt) and glyph atlas (distance map in . The command line program otf2bdf is such a converter. Bitmap Font Generator. One of them is font. To do this I'm using FreeImage. load("arial. That The FNT file extension stands for Windows Font File and is used by the Windows operating system to store bitmap fonts. getmask(char)) im. truetype("font. The Aug 9, 2012 · An important thing to note is that the loadBitmap() function expects a path to a bitmap font image that only has black, white and shades of grey which black being the background color. However, Unity’s TextMeshPro Font Asset Creator does not accept PNG files, as it only works with OTF/TTF vector fonts. Sep 14, 2017 · If you search on the web for bitmap fonts you don’t find much that’s large (taller than 12 pixels) and good. The FNT file extension stands for Windows Font File and is used by the Windows operating system to store bitmap fonts. Researching on internet I found this tutorial: YouTube Tutorial about BitmapFont. In the Digit tab, set the numbers. As soon as you add a strike to a new font, the font will become a bitmap only font. FON font in FontForge; Choose File->Generate Fonts; Select "(faked) MS bitmap only sfnt (ttf)" as type, entre a file name and click "save". " so I guess png file won Dot matrix sizes up to 1024 x 768, supports BMP,JPEG,PNG,ICO,TIFF,GIF animation . GraphicsGale: A pixel art editor with built-in bitmap font creation capabilities. Customize the font size and spacing between characters. PNGs are raster (=bitmap) images and there exists bitmap fonts and their editors. i found this font and want to use it in my game. 2. This is the script: But, on Godot 4. Follow the next step of the tutorial in the next chapter. Efficient Glyph Packing. ) turn on the [*] As Background flag. The only thing missing is xml formatted font file export, it’s text only :( May 14, 2012 · You can use bitmap fonts for GUIText and 3DText objects; OnGUI code can only use . The best way to do this is to look for some bitmap font editor, for example BitFonter . Download for macOS. (0-9A-Za-z) AuthorName. ttf -fill black -size "240x240" label:"0" +repage -depth 8 [email protected] where "0" is the character mapped for any of my icons. <fontFamily> + <fontSize> margin: number: Number of pixels that the chars will be separated in the . Generate font assets, i. . I need to properly set up a bitmap font so that Unity recognizes it as a usable font asset. Modern fonts are vectors instead of bitmaps, usually in TrueType (TTF) or related font formats, so we'll need a converter. dib: MIME: font/ttf: image/bmp, image/x-bmp: Developed by: Apple Computer: Microsoft: Type of format: Outline font: Raster graphics: Introduction: TrueType is an outline font standard developed by Apple and Microsoft in the late 1980s as a competitor to Adobe's Jun 17, 2013 · As suggested by @imcaspar, but I need it to convert icons in ttf font to png with specific sizes for ios integration. I'm creating a FreeImage bitmap via the FreeImage_ConvertFromRawBits function. bmp, . ff file format is a bitmap format. xml and . i searched online for a while and found a reddit thread from 6 years ago with most of the tools mentioned taken down. png char-width char-height There seem to be no good bitmap font formats and also the tools for editing them are all very old and crappy. I unzipped the zip file which resulted in 2 files. Requirements Requires Mac OS X 10. And it should work. Nov 21, 2011 · I have all the characters of a font rendered in a PNG. If you want to autotrace a bitmap font then (from the FontView) (You will probably want to start out with a new font, but you might not) File ‣ Import. I want to use the PNG for texture-mapped font rendering in OpenGL, but I need to extract the glyph information - character position and size, etc. png image. png: 🔸 MIME type: font/ttf: image/png: 🔸 Developed by: Apple Computer: PNG Development Group: 🔸 Type of format: outline font: lossless bitmap image format: 🔸 Description: TrueType is an outline font standard developed by Apple and Microsoft in the late 1980s as a competitor to Adobe's Type 1 fonts used in PostScript. I tried to load the bitmap font using the appropriate command in the preload function of the game as follows: The best of the lossless image formats is called PNG (Portable Network Graphics). Font generation is controlled by the GUI thread (even though it spawns multiple threads to speed up the work). Since my goal is to produce a fixed-width font, each character will be a uniform 8x8 “pixels” in size. fnt format and a . This format is widely supported by web browsers and image viewers/editors. Any other type of bitmap font won't work with this parser. There are several examples available at github and npm to help you get started. The . PNG PNG or Portable Network Graphic format is a graphic file format that uses lossless compression algorithm to store raster images. fnt文件,这两个文件就是程序中所 Jun 21, 2021 · Copy all the bitmap font png files under the system folder from the sample project to yours. You can accomplish it in 4 ways: Font upload - you can upload a font file directly from your local files. png to BitmapFont. CLOSEIMPORT. Jan 15, 2015 · Hi fellow devs! I’d like to share with you an app I’ve been working on for the past couple months. Jul 11, 2014 · A more concise, and more reliable version of the other answers (which cut off parts of some glyphs for me): import string from PIL import Image, ImageFont point_size = 16 font = ImageFont. I was given a . For installed fonts on your PC: Select System; For downloaded font files: Select File and choose a font by clicking In the menubar, select File → Save BMFont files (text) Choose a save location and filename ending In the Font Settings dialog, you can select the font you want to export, set the font size, and adjust various other settings. org)without the access to a TTF file of the image's characters or any other typical font formats. jar; Select the font you want to convert. Bitmap fonts The bitmap font is composed of a font file in . lowercase: im = Image. DATA IMPORT / EXPORT. PNG format stores graphical information in a compressed form. In our case, each image is 256 pixels in height. png file is compressed automatically and you can ajust various settings from the configuration object that is passed into the generator script. Now I want to use this font as a . Here, name your font and set the font UPM value to the multiple of the image’s height that is closest to 750. png文件和一个. ttf font) into a bitmap font (XML + PNG). Photoshop CC 2017 supports OpenType-SVG fonts and you could leverage your PS skills to create fonts with Fontself, an add-on that runs within Photoshop (I am one of its creators ;) Nov 30, 2021 · About making font from PNG images: It's possible. There are even web services which generate fonts from bitmap images but they require the images as strictly scaled and placed into a given frame. com). 4. b. Mar 30, 2022 · I have deleted my previous font asset and created a new one from scratch. Bitmap fonts don't do scaled sizes very well. There’s some info about using a texture as a font here, though if you don’t have a matching . www. Latest version: 1. the font is a spritesheet and i cant find any tutorials on using it in godot so i used a addon that converts png to bitmap and it cam out as a huge mess no matter what i tried. There is a new font format called OpenType-SVG that lets you do this (so the output will be actually be a bitmap font). Specify the character range to include in the bitmap font. woff2. When the status change to “Done” click the “Download TEXT” button File Format PNG (Portable Network Graphics) PNG files (which are commonly called "ping") are a format that contains bitmapped or raster images. Apr 4, 2025 · TTF (TrueType Font) is a font standard developed in the late 1980s by Apple and Microsoft, which is widely used for both operating system and application fonts. What I did was to create a bitmap font using BMFONT, wrote a few scripts to add extra icons downloaded from internet into the bitmap font file. bmp, or . Fonts. dfont. . bmp") Hello! This tool takes a pixel font as an image and makes an actual TTF file out of it! Workflow: Draw your font in your preferred editor. Requirements: python3, Pillow, fontforge. Select your font file PNG is a raster graphic data storage format that uses lossless compression algorithm to Deflate. You can even upload your own fonts to the editor and use them to add text to a photo, with your OWN fonts. Show variants. Then go into your project settings, plugins, and enable the plugin called "Bitmap Font Creator". fnt file provides an index of each character thumbnail. Choose from a (soon-to-be) massive selection of Photoshop-quality presets and tweak shadows, strokes, and fills to your Get the free font generator tool here: https://martin-senges. bmp (Sorry if I'm reviving an old thread – but this thread has great info and I didn't see any new info anywhere else – and figured I'd pass on these updates to the info here. SETTINGS. png file. I want to use it with Pillow as ImageFont but there's no info on this in Pillow docs. I was unable to find any bitmap fonts I could use with PhaserJS, so I compiled a few basic ones. png) from a . png image) draw your characters Apr 19, 2015 · The point here: changing the size of a bitmap font is a major change to the font itself, not just a trivial matter of different ways to look at the same data. You need to enable JavaScript to run this app. More export formats are in the works. Load the . be/4HNYNhL_yI8My website: htt Apr 9, 2019 · 所以工具Bitmap Font Generator帮我们解决了这问题,如何使用,让我们一步步开始吧!。。。 准备工作: 0到9共十张图片资源:如图0: 通过 Bitmap Font Generator 把我们上面准备好的多个数字图片打包成两个文件,一个. Complex fonts might get slow and painful to edit - in this case, work on a cut down set of characters and add the full set when you’re happy. 0, last published: 7 months ago. wcki qwqsy bjipw geqjy odkw ymeane zjwnp tusr bjld ufeu tpfpn gbfeb jcrvdmk nibmwcs miuur